Abstract

The invention provides an image reading apparatus for performing high-precision image read by canceling out noise based on digital signal processing and superimposed on an effective portion of an analog signal. The image reading apparatus superimposes digital-based data and data-clock-based fixed noise on an sensor output signal in reference data acquiring operation as well to output data with the fixed data being canceled out in image read-operation.
